Running svg-sprite, grunt-svg-sprite or gulp-svg-sprite with the following minimal configuration
var config = {
"mode": {
"css": {
"render": {
"css": true
},
"example": true
}
}
};
should result in the this output (cache busting hash omitted for clarity):
out/
`-- css
|-- sprite.css
|-- sprite.css.html
`-- svg
`-- sprite.css.svg
